5 Celebrities We Wish Would Launch A Fashion Line

Starting a personal line, whether it’s for clothing or shoes or makeup, seems to be the natural progression for celebrities in Hollywood these days. We see their faces broadcast on TV, and soon enough we see them splayed on a perfume bottle in a department store. These five trendsetting celebs, however, have yet to jump on the fashion line bandwagon- but we really wish they woud soon. From the red carpet to the streets, these ladies never fail to dress incredibly well. Until they actually do launch their own fashion lines, we’ll just have to keep admiring their style from afar and attempt to mimic it on our own.

1. Blake Lively

Blake Lively’s style extends far beyond the Gossip Girl set. She capitlizes on bright, popping colors and fun patterns and fabrics to make even the most simple of outfits look stunning. She knows how to accessorize but doesn’t go over the top. She apparently told Refinery 29 in an interview two years ago that she has no plans to start a clothing line and is instead focusing on acting, but we’re going to keep our fingers crossed. 

2. Kate Bosworth

Kate has already launched her own jewelry line, JewelMint, but what we really want is for this best dressed star to start designing clothes. She has the laid-back, bohemian look down to a tee, always looking effortlessly put-together even when just wearing slouchy pants, but she clearly knows how to dress up too. 

3. Rachel Bilson

When it comes to clothes and fashion, Rachel Bilson can do no wrong. She’s been consistently noted as a fashionable celebrity since her days on the O.C. She keeps it simple, often sticking to jeans with blazers or jackets, so if she were to start her own line we know there would be great casual options for us. She does design shoes for her website and line ShoeMint, but we want more from Bilson!

4. Leighton Meester

Of course the other co-star of Gossip Girl, which features arguably the most fashionable clothes on TV each epsiode, had to make the list. While it’s nearly impossible to live up to Blair Waldorf’s status, Leighton Meester does an impressive job and has become a style icon of her own. She’s mastered the art of adding bold statement pieces to her wardrobe, whether it’s patterened pants or leather cut-outs that look sophisticated, not skanky. 

5. Lucy Hale

This Pretty Little Liar knows how to dress, and we’d love to wear her style (and have her defined eyebrows and glowing skin tone too, please). She may be relatively new to the Red Carpet, but Lucy has been working it like a seasoned celebrity. We can’t wait to see what she wears next- and if it’ll ever be a personal design from the line that we’re wishing she’d make.
